What is the postal code of Orsières?
Orsières has 4 postal codes: 1937, 1938, 1943, 1944.
What is the tax rate in Orsières?
The municipal tax multiplier of Orsières is 120% (2026); canton VS levies 100%.
How much tax do you pay in Orsières?
A single person without children pays about 15'585 CHF income tax in Orsières on 100'000 CHF gross income (federal, cantonal, municipal), rank 70 of 122 in canton VS. Source: ESTV (2026).
How many residents does Orsières have?
Orsières has 3'339 residents (2025).
How many foreign residents live in Orsières?
Orsières has 613 foreign residents, a share of 18.36% (2025).
